如何从GitHub导入到IDEA:详尽指南

在现代软件开发中,使用版本控制系统已经成为一种标准实践。GitHub作为最流行的代码托管平台之一,拥有大量的开源项目。而IntelliJ IDEA(简称IDEA)是开发者常用的集成开发环境之一。在这篇文章中,我们将详细探讨如何将GitHub上的项目导入到IDEA中,帮助你快速开始项目开发。

1. 准备工作

在开始之前,确保你已安装好以下软件:

  • IntelliJ IDEA(建议使用最新版本)
  • Git(用于版本控制)

1.1 安装Git

  1. 访问Git官方网站

  2. 根据你的操作系统下载并安装Git。

  3. 安装完成后,在终端(Windows为CMD或PowerShell,Mac为Terminal)中输入以下命令以确认安装成功: bash git –version

    如果返回版本号,表示安装成功。

2. 从GitHub获取项目链接

在将项目导入到IDEA之前,你需要获取项目的链接:

  1. 打开你想要导入的GitHub项目页面。
  2. 点击页面右上角的“Code”按钮。
  3. 选择使用HTTPS或SSH链接(建议使用HTTPS,特别是对于初学者),然后复制链接。

3. 在IDEA中导入项目

3.1 使用Git克隆项目

  1. 打开IntelliJ IDEA,在欢迎界面选择“Get from VCS”选项。
  2. 在弹出的窗口中,将之前复制的项目链接粘贴到URL框中。
  3. 选择项目保存路径。
  4. 点击“Clone”按钮,IDEA会开始克隆项目。
    Clone Project
  5. 克隆完成后,IDEA会自动打开该项目。

3.2 使用Existing Sources导入项目

如果你已经有了项目的文件,可以选择以下步骤:

  1. IDEA的欢迎界面选择“Open”或“Import Project”。
  2. 找到你本地的项目文件夹,选择它并点击“OK”。
  3. 根据提示进行项目设置,通常IDEA会自动识别项目结构。

4. 配置项目

在导入项目后,你可能需要做一些基本的配置:

  • SDK配置:确保项目使用合适的SDK版本。可以通过File > Project Structure来设置。
  • 依赖管理:如果项目使用Maven或Gradle,请确保IDEA能够下载并管理项目的依赖。通常IDEA会自动进行处理。

5. 常见问题解答(FAQ)

5.1 如何解决导入项目时出现的错误?

在导入项目时,可能会出现以下常见错误:

  • SDK不匹配:确保项目所需的JDK版本与你的IDEA中的设置一致。
  • 依赖缺失:检查项目的pom.xml(Maven)或build.gradle(Gradle)文件,确保所有依赖项都能成功下载。

5.2 如何更新GitHub上的代码到IDEA?

  1. 在IDEA中,打开你的项目。
  2. 点击VCS > Git > Pull以拉取远程仓库的最新代码。
  3. 处理合并冲突,如果有的话。

5.3 如何将本地代码推送到GitHub?

  1. 在IDEA中完成你的更改后,确保保存。
  2. 点击VCS > Git > Commit提交你的更改。
  3. 输入提交信息,然后点击“Commit and Push”。
  4. 根据提示选择推送到的分支,确认即可。

6. 总结

通过本文,我们详细介绍了如何从GitHub导入项目到IDEA,包括准备工作、克隆项目的步骤、配置项目以及常见问题的解答。掌握这些知识,能够有效提高你的开发效率,帮助你更好地管理和维护你的项目。希望这篇文章能对你有所帮助!

如果你对从GitHub导入到IDEA还有其他疑问,欢迎在评论区留言!

正文完